Why You Should Wear White Year Round

The old fashion rule of not wearing white after Labor Day is some archaic suggestion that doesn't even make sense. Wearing white doesn’t have to be restricted to a certain time of the year and shouldn’t. There’s no real evidence as to why white was frowned upon after summer’s last holiday, but some suggest that it might have originated because it’s the No. 1 color to wear if you want to stay cool. And since summer is over after Labor Day, there’s no need to wear it.

Another myth as to why the saying was created is that it was a sign of wealth back in the 1800s, and was based on snobbery. Wearing white in summer might have been a way for rich people to separate themselves from poorer individuals. If you were rich enough, you’d be able to escape the dirty city to wear white. Whatever its origins are, the truth is, you should be able to wear white whenever you please! Here are some reasons why:
